Title Tag

The title of your blog will be a search engine’s first step in determining the relevancy of your content. Google calls this the “title tag”

Be sure to include your keyword within the first 60 characters of your title or lower depending on pixels size coz the length of the title is based on 500 to 600 pixels.

Where is the best place to put a long keyword in the title tag? If it is a lengthy headline, it is a good idea to get your keyword in the beginning for it has the chance that Google will cut it off in SERP.

Headers & Body

Incorporate your long-tail keywords throughout the body of your post and the headers. But be as natural as possible and reader-friendly. don’t overboard to avoid keyword stuffing.

Before writing a new post, you’ll think about how to include these keywords into your content. But that is not your primary purpose. It is the content you can give to your website visitors. Focus on answering your visitors’ questions through your post.

Meta Description

The meta description is simply the short or summary information about your content. Be sure you include your keywords in this section. Both Google and the visitors are clear what is the content all about.

Always consider when doing content on this copy format, make it relevant and enriched with the specific intent of your website visitors as let me say a CTR or Click-through-rate.
